Data-driven Bayesian network modelling to explore the relationships between SDG 6 and the 2030 Agenda (R Code). April, 2021.

D. Requejo-Castro, R. Giné-Garriga & A. Pérez-Foguet
These R files contain the code carry out the identification of the interlinkages between SDG 6 and the 2030 Agenda. The method is explained in detail in the following paper: Requejo-Castro, D., Giné-Garriga, R., Pérez-Foguet, A., 2020. Data-driven Bayesian Network modelling to explore the relationships between SDG 6 and the 2030 Agenda. Sci. Total Environ. 710, 136014. https://doi.org/10.1016/j.scitotenv.2019.136014. BayOTA: Bay Optimization Tools for Analysis - Beta 2

Daniel E. Kaufman
Bay Optimization Tools for Analysis (BayOTA) is a framework for identifying low-cost implementation options for a distinct subset of Best Management Practices (BMPs)—a subset containing BMPs are represented by scalar load reduction effectiveness factors—in the Chesapeake Bay Program's most recent (Phase 6) watershed model, which is known as the Chesapeake Assessment Scenario Tool (CAST). Grid of upper atmosphere models and interpolation tool

Daria Kubyshkina & Luca Fossati
This package contains a python tool allowing one to get a quick estimate of mass-loss rates from planets heated by stellar XUV based on hydrodynamic modeling. This is done by interpolation within the grid of upper atmosphere models being an extension of the one presented in Kubyshkina et al., 2018. Covid Severity Program

Bryan Todd
The program is an HTML file that opens in any major browser (such as Firefox) that supports HTML5. When opened and every time the browser is refreshed, the program downloads Covid-19 data ("dpc-covid19-ita-regioni.csv") for Italy from the GitHub website, analyses it by two different methods, and displays the resulting graphs of the severity of the pandemic. kim: Functions for Behavioral Science Researchers (an R package)

Jin Kim
This R package contains various functions that simplify and expedite analyses of experimental data. Examples include a function that plots sample means of groups in a factorial experimental design, a function that conducts robust regressions with bootstrapped samples, and a function that conducts robust two-way analysis of variance.
